766 Deputy Aengus Ó Snodaigh asked the Minister for Education and Science if he will make a statement detailing the way in which he envisages that the prevention pillar of the national drugs strategy can be fully delivered upon following his decision to reduce the number of special, personal and health education support staff; and the way his Department will deliver on its responsibility to monitor the substance use policies of schools. [12747/10]
